Re: NFL 2023 - Week 18 - Down the Stretch They Come!
No, I don't think so. Or at least it shouldn't matter, but their ownership insists that beating Green Bay is more important than beating other opponents because they are terrible.degenerasian wrote: ↑Fri Jan 05, 2024 4:26 pmIf Fields has a career game and knocks out the Packers, will that change anything?DSafetyGuy wrote: ↑Mon Jan 01, 2024 3:46 pm Oh, my fault. The Bears have until May to pick up the fifth-year option on Fields. They're still not going to do it, as drafting will push the cost of a quarterback contract extension down the road a few years.
I think the only thing that can make them keep Fields is some team offers them a preposterously bigger trade package for #1 overall than what they got for #1 this season. Carolina gave them D.J. Moore, 2023 first- and second-round picks (#9 and #61 overall), 2024 first-round pick (turned out to be #1 overall, but the Panthers looked grim before the season), and a 2025 second-round pick (TBD, but it's hard to say it won't be a top-40 pick at this point). I don't know what some team would offer that could possibly exceed that, especially because the Panthers have been ripped for making that trade, and not just because Young looks like a bust.

Re: NFL 2023 - Week 18 - Down the Stretch They Come!
Even if they don't have to move until May on his contract, I'd guess the Bears will be highly motivated to trade him before the NFL draft. Partly because a trade partner would be more interested in acquiring Fields before they invest in a rookie themselves, and partly because if the Bears draft a QB, their leverage on trading Fields has to go way down.
